IC TTL/H/L SERIES, QUAD 2-INPUT NAND GATE, CDIP14, Gate
|
Part Life Cycle Code | Obsolete | |
Ihs Manufacturer | NXP SEMICONDUCTORS | |
Package Description | DIP, DIP14,.3 | |
Reach Compliance Code | unknown | |
HTS Code | 8542.39.00.01 | |
Family | TTL/H/L | |
JESD-30 Code | R-GDIP-T14 | |
JESD-609 Code | e0 | |
Load Capacitance (CL) | 25 pF | |
Logic IC Type | NAND GATE | |
Max I(ol) | 0.02 A | |
Number of Functions | 4 | |
Number of Inputs | 2 | |
Number of Terminals | 14 | |
Operating Temperature-Max | 70 °C | |
Operating Temperature-Min | ||
Package Body Material | CERAMIC, GLASS-SEALED | |
Package Code | DIP | |
Package Equivalence Code | DIP14,.3 | |
Package Shape | RECTANGULAR | |
Package Style | IN-LINE | |
Power Supply Current-Max (ICC) | 40 mA | |
Prop. Delay@Nom-Sup | 10 ns | |
Propagation Delay (tpd) | 10 ns | |
Qualification Status | Not Qualified | |
Schmitt Trigger | NO | |
Supply Voltage-Max (Vsup) | 5.25 V | |
Supply Voltage-Min (Vsup) | 4.75 V | |
Supply Voltage-Nom (Vsup) | 5 V | |
Surface Mount | NO | |
Technology | TTL | |
Temperature Grade | COMMERCIAL | |
Terminal Finish | TIN LEAD | |
Terminal Form | THROUGH-HOLE | |
Terminal Pitch | 2.54 mm | |
Terminal Position | DUAL |
